Sudbury Students Grab Degrees From Bowdoin
Congrats to these four Sudbury residents, who graduated from Bowdoin College.

During Bowdoin College’s 210th Commencement ceremony, held May 23, 2015, bachelor of arts degrees were awarded to students from 36 states, the District of Columbia, and 18 other countries and territories, said an announcement.
Cordelia Miller, of Sudbury, a member of the Class of 2015, graduated cum laude from Bowdoin College with a major in Art History and a minor in Italian.
Connor Quinn, of Sudbury, a member of the Class of 2015, graduated from Bowdoin College with a major in Government and Legal Studies and a minor in English.

Jacqueline Sullivan, of Sudbury, a member of the Class of 2015, graduated from Bowdoin College with a major in Economics and a minor in Environmental Studies.
John Swords, of Sudbury, a member of the Class of 2015, graduated cum laude from Bowdoin College with a major in Government and Legal Studies .
